About This Vintage 1972 Edition
"The Early Christians After the Death of the Apostles" by Eberhard Arnold, published by Plough Publishing House in Rifton, New York, is a second edition released in 1972. This work, originally published in 1926, delves into the history of early Christianity following the era of the apostles. Eberhard Arnold, a significant figure in religious studies, offers insights selected and edited from early sources. This edition, translated and edited by the Society of Brothers, distinguishes itself with its historical depth and scholarly approach.
